1. When installing a vertical axial flow pump, ensure the motor shaft and pump base are properly aligned. This ensures that the centrifugal pump's rubber bearing holes on either side are perpendicular to the rolling bearing holes of the motor shaft bracket. This process is referred to as alignment and centering. Alignment and centering are mutually dependent, and it requires multiple iterations to achieve both level and vertical alignment that meets standards.
During the assembly of the pump shell components, the centerlines of the guide vane housing, the centrifugal impeller housing, and the waterproof sleeve should align with the centerline of the pump base. The parallelism should be between φ0.3 to 0.5mm; the level deviation on the pump base flange surface should not exceed 0.05/1000; and all sliding flange surfaces should fit tightly without any leakage.
3. According to the centrifugal pump design logo, position the base of the centrifugal pump. After securely fastening the guide vane body and the intermediate flange with screws, place them together on the base, aligning the intermediate flange position so that the centerline and the axis of the centrifugal pump's leak water intake pipe coincide. Additionally, use a level to check the flatness of the flange surface.
4. After the pump housing assembly is aligned and leveled, and the concrete strength at the local foot bolt area reaches over 90%, the assembly of the rotating components can begin. The key to the axial flow pump installation is the flatness of the centrifugal pump and motor base; as well as the concentricity and flatness of the pump shaft, rotating shaft, and motor shaft. These three standards must be considered separately, without looking back and forth.
After aligning and straightening the axial flow pump, tighten the machine and pump support foot screws to ensure that it can fully exert its enhanced efficiency and function in future applications.
